I was messing around with Prime 2.2 CLI templates - I had created a number of variables that I realized I no longer needed, so went to delete them in the Managed Variables window. Each time I would delete one, Prime would pop up a warning telling me that although I was deleting it from the Managed Variables window, I would still need to delete any references that were present in my CLI code. Well, since I had about 8 or so of these to delete, after the 4th one, I decided to tick the option in the warning box that said "Don't warn me about this again." After that, I am no longer able to delete variables in the Managed Variables window. I select a variable, the Delete button becomes active, I click it ... and nothing happens. It seems dismissing the warning prevents me from deleting variables now. Is there a way to re-enable that warning so I can at least continue to delete variables?
I'm using Prime 2.2.1 (maintenance release 1, device pack 2), running on a VM
